Release 0.7.32
This commit is contained in:
@@ -1,6 +1,6 @@
|
|||||||
{
|
{
|
||||||
"name": "rrweb",
|
"name": "rrweb",
|
||||||
"version": "0.7.31",
|
"version": "0.7.32",
|
||||||
"description": "record and replay the web",
|
"description": "record and replay the web",
|
||||||
"scripts": {
|
"scripts": {
|
||||||
"test": "npm run bundle:browser && cross-env TS_NODE_CACHE=false TS_NODE_FILES=true mocha -r ts-node/register test/**/*.test.ts",
|
"test": "npm run bundle:browser && cross-env TS_NODE_CACHE=false TS_NODE_FILES=true mocha -r ts-node/register test/**/*.test.ts",
|
||||||
|
|||||||
77
typings/replay/index.d.ts
vendored
77
typings/replay/index.d.ts
vendored
@@ -2,44 +2,41 @@ import Timer from './timer';
|
|||||||
import { eventWithTime, playerConfig, playerMetaData, Handler } from '../types';
|
import { eventWithTime, playerConfig, playerMetaData, Handler } from '../types';
|
||||||
import './styles/style.css';
|
import './styles/style.css';
|
||||||
export declare class Replayer {
|
export declare class Replayer {
|
||||||
wrapper: HTMLDivElement;
|
wrapper: HTMLDivElement;
|
||||||
iframe: HTMLIFrameElement;
|
iframe: HTMLIFrameElement;
|
||||||
timer: Timer;
|
timer: Timer;
|
||||||
private events;
|
private events;
|
||||||
private config;
|
private config;
|
||||||
private mouse;
|
private mouse;
|
||||||
private emitter;
|
private emitter;
|
||||||
private baselineTime;
|
private baselineTime;
|
||||||
private lastPlayedEvent;
|
private lastPlayedEvent;
|
||||||
private nextUserInteractionEvent;
|
private nextUserInteractionEvent;
|
||||||
private noramlSpeed;
|
private noramlSpeed;
|
||||||
private missingNodeRetryMap;
|
private missingNodeRetryMap;
|
||||||
private playing;
|
private playing;
|
||||||
constructor(
|
constructor(events: Array<eventWithTime | string>, config?: Partial<playerConfig>);
|
||||||
events: Array<eventWithTime | string>,
|
on(event: string, handler: Handler): void;
|
||||||
config?: Partial<playerConfig>,
|
setConfig(config: Partial<playerConfig>): void;
|
||||||
);
|
getMetaData(): playerMetaData;
|
||||||
on(event: string, handler: Handler): void;
|
getCurrentTime(): number;
|
||||||
setConfig(config: Partial<playerConfig>): void;
|
getTimeOffset(): number;
|
||||||
getMetaData(): playerMetaData;
|
play(timeOffset?: number): void;
|
||||||
getCurrentTime(): number;
|
pause(): void;
|
||||||
getTimeOffset(): number;
|
resume(timeOffset?: number): void;
|
||||||
play(timeOffset?: number): void;
|
addEvent(rawEvent: eventWithTime | string): void;
|
||||||
pause(): void;
|
private setupDom;
|
||||||
resume(timeOffset?: number): void;
|
private handleResize;
|
||||||
addEvent(rawEvent: eventWithTime | string): void;
|
private getDelay;
|
||||||
private setupDom;
|
private getCastFn;
|
||||||
private handleResize;
|
private rebuildFullSnapshot;
|
||||||
private getDelay;
|
private waitForStylesheetLoad;
|
||||||
private getCastFn;
|
private applyIncremental;
|
||||||
private rebuildFullSnapshot;
|
private resolveMissingNode;
|
||||||
private waitForStylesheetLoad;
|
private moveAndHover;
|
||||||
private applyIncremental;
|
private hoverElements;
|
||||||
private resolveMissingNode;
|
private isUserInteraction;
|
||||||
private moveAndHover;
|
private restoreSpeed;
|
||||||
private hoverElements;
|
private warnNodeNotFound;
|
||||||
private isUserInteraction;
|
private debugNodeNotFound;
|
||||||
private restoreSpeed;
|
|
||||||
private warnNodeNotFound;
|
|
||||||
private debugNodeNotFound;
|
|
||||||
}
|
}
|
||||||
|
|||||||
Reference in New Issue
Block a user